The electric stainless steel flange ball valve is a sophisticated and highly efficient valve system that combines the durability of stainless steel with the precision of electric control. This type of valve is widely used in various industrial applications due to its robustness, reliability, and ease of use.

At its core, the electric stainless steel flange ball valve consists of a spherical ball with a hole drilled through its center. This ball rotates within a valve body to control the flow of fluids through the pipeline. The valve’s flange design allows it to be securely bolted to the pipeline, providing a strong and leak-proof connection. The electric actuator, mounted on top of the valve, enables precise control of the ball’s position through electric signals.

One of the primary advantages of using stainless steel for the valve body is its exceptional resistance to corrosion and high temperatures. Stainless steel is ideal for handling aggressive fluids, such as acids or alkalis, and can withstand extreme operating conditions. This makes the electric stainless steel flange ball valve suitable for applications in chemical processing, oil and gas, water treatment, and other demanding industries. The integration of an electric actuator into the ball valve system enhances its functionality and versatility. Electric actuators allow for remote operation and automation, which is particularly useful in complex systems requiring precise control. The actuator converts electrical signals into mechanical movement, adjusting the valve’s position to open or close the flow as needed. This remote control capability simplifies the management of valve operations and improves overall efficiency.
